Output 5bf2954e016566190c279bd6031e5748e310e524a77d54731ac364816236b9ba:1

value
21478800
script pubkey
OP_0 OP_PUSHBYTES_20 86f7ec86884379d4aa0961f8f211552fb2675342
address
bc1qsmm7ep5ggduaf2sfv8u0yy2497exw56zj7rhte
transaction
5bf2954e016566190c279bd6031e5748e310e524a77d54731ac364816236b9ba
confirmations
121735
spent
true